I have to disagree with it not being reference in Doyle's Writings. In Silver Blaze, Doyle writes: "…the corner of a first-class carriage flying along en route for Exeter, while Sherlock Holmes, with his sharp, eager face framed in his ear-flapped travelling-cap, dipped rapidly in to the bundle of fresh papers which he had secured at Paddington… ". I think an ear-flapped cap describes a deerstalker.

Look, the deerstalker hat was popular in the 1880s, and Silver Blaze was published in 1892, I think, which is a point in your favor. However, it was considered more of a gentleman's sporting cap. I simply feel doubtful that Holmes would have been the least bit interested in sportswear, nor would he have worn sportswear while traveling or while working. I feel it's more likely to have been a simple work wear cap with a flap, since it is mentioned that Holmes uses it for traveling. I disagree that a deerstalker was specifically referenced in any way. Holmes had a lot of different pieces in his wardrobe, clearly, as he was often going incognito or wearing disguises that would even fool Watson. I feel it is much less likely that when traveling, he would be drawing attention by wearing gentleman's sportswear. His rooms were clearly a mess of different things related to his professional work and studies. In all 56 plus 4, it is never mentioned that he undertakes any normal social leisure activities for a gentleman of the time, such as hunting. He was either working, doing experiments, playing violin, smoking, or doing drugs out of boredom. I believe for hats he most likely wore normal, low key stuff, whatever was of the most utility in his work, and things that did not stand out. Not leisure wear. Of course, this is my opinion.
